DC‐magnetometry Analytical Tool Driven by Spin Ordering Phenomena for Sensing Chemical Interactions at the Surface of Nanomaterials

open access: yesAdvanced Science, EarlyView.
The adsorption of AsV on akaganeite nanorods was found to provide a magnetic signature. A change in the surface spin order gave rise to a second peak in the zero‐field cooled curve. AsIII adsorption does not provide any change in the magnetic behavior of the sorbent.

Remote Magnetomechanical Neuromodulation Uncovers Therapeutic Mechanisms for Alleviating Parkinsonian Symptoms in Freely Moving Mice

open access: yesAdvanced Science, EarlyView.
Magnetomechanical neuromodulation using magnetic nanodiscs enables remote activation of neurons. In a hemiparkinsonian mouse model, alternating magnetic fields actuate the nanodiscs to generate torque that opens mechanosensitive ion channels within the subthalamic nucleus, thereby modulating basal ganglia motor circuitry.

The Third‐Generation Magnetic Super‐Stable Mineralizer: Complete Removal and Separation of Multiple Heavy Metal Pollutants

open access: yesAdvanced Science, EarlyView.
The 3rd‐generation magnetic super‐stable mineralizer M‐MgAl‐700 features a core‐shell structure, strong superparamagnetism, large surface area, and abundant oxygen defects. It achieves exceptional Cd(II) and As(V) mineralization capacities, reducing both pollutants in co‐contaminated water and soil to meet national standards.
